22 lines
584 B
Java
22 lines
584 B
Java
package de.mummeit.pmg.exception;
|
|
|
|
/**
|
|
* Exception thrown when a permission request is invalid.
|
|
*/
|
|
public class InvalidPermissionRequestException extends PermissionManagerException {
|
|
private final String reason;
|
|
|
|
public InvalidPermissionRequestException(String message, String reason) {
|
|
super(message);
|
|
this.reason = reason;
|
|
}
|
|
|
|
public InvalidPermissionRequestException(String message, String reason, Throwable cause) {
|
|
super(message, cause);
|
|
this.reason = reason;
|
|
}
|
|
|
|
public String getReason() {
|
|
return reason;
|
|
}
|
|
} |